The Numbers Tell the Story: USDT’s Market Supremacy

Tether’s dominance in the stablecoin market is both comprehensive and growing. As of 2025, USDT commands approximately 68.2% of the global stablecoin market share, a significant increase from 61.9% in January 2024. With a market capitalization exceeding $163 billion, Tether has established itself not just as the largest stablecoin, but as one of the most significant cryptocurrencies by any measure.

The scale of USDT’s daily activity is perhaps even more impressive than its market cap. Daily trading volumes consistently surpass $75 billion, regularly outpacing even Bitcoin and Ethereum in terms of transaction volume. Recent data shows 24-hour trading volumes reaching as high as $99 billion, demonstrating the extraordinary liquidity and utility that USDT provides to the global crypto ecosystem.

This trading activity translates into real-world usage across multiple blockchain networks. Tether is now issued on 13 different blockchains, making it the most widely adopted stablecoin across networks. The Tron blockchain hosts the largest supply of USDT at over 51.6 billion tokens, followed by Ethereum at 35.4 billion. This multi-chain approach has been crucial to USDT’s success, allowing users to choose the most cost-effective or suitable network for their specific needs.

The number of USDT addresses has grown steadily and now exceeds 25 million, reflecting widespread adoption among both individual users and institutions. This growth trajectory shows no signs of slowing, with some networks like Optimism seeing 302% growth in USDT wallets, while Arbitrum experienced a 173% increase, indicating strong adoption across newer blockchain technologies.

Beyond Trading: The Gaming and Entertainment Revolution

While Tether’s role in cryptocurrency trading is well-documented, its impact on online gaming and digital entertainment represents one of the most fascinating applications of stablecoin technology. The online casino and gaming industry has embraced USDT with remarkable enthusiasm, fundamentally changing how players interact with digital entertainment platforms.

The appeal of USDT in online casinos stems from its unique combination of stability and accessibility. Unlike Bitcoin or Ethereum, whose values can fluctuate dramatically within hours, USDT maintains its 1:1 peg to the US dollar. This stability is crucial for gaming applications where players need to calculate risk and manage their bankrolls with precision. When a player deposits $1,000 worth of USDT for an online poker session, they can be confident that their balance will retain its dollar value throughout their gaming experience, regardless of broader cryptocurrency market movements.

The speed and cost advantages of USDT, particularly on networks like Tron, have made it the preferred choice for both players and gaming operators. On the Tron network (TRC-20), USDT transfers are confirmed in under a minute and typically cost less than $1, with fees often ranging from $0.40 to $3.38 depending on the recipient wallet’s status. This represents a dramatic improvement over traditional banking methods, which might take days for international transfers and charge substantial fees.

For online casinos, USDT offers additional advantages in terms of regulatory compliance and operational efficiency. The transparency of blockchain transactions provides an immutable record of all deposits and withdrawals, while the pseudonymous nature of cryptocurrency addresses allows operators to serve global markets without the complexity of traditional banking relationships in multiple jurisdictions.

The gaming industry’s adoption of USDT has also driven innovation in payment processing and user experience. Many platforms now offer instant deposits and withdrawals, allowing players to move funds in and out of gaming platforms with unprecedented speed. This has fundamentally changed player behavior, enabling more dynamic bankroll management and reducing the friction that traditionally existed between fiat currency and online gaming platforms.

Technical Infrastructure: The Foundation of Success

Tether’s technical architecture represents a masterclass in blockchain interoperability and scalability. Unlike cryptocurrencies that exist on a single blockchain, USDT’s multi-chain approach has been crucial to its widespread adoption. This strategy allows users to choose the most appropriate network based on their specific needs, whether prioritizing low costs, high speed, or maximum security.

The Tron network has emerged as the dominant platform for USDT transactions, handling approximately 76% of all USDT transfers when combined with Ethereum. Tron’s appeal lies in its combination of speed and cost-effectiveness. With a 3-second block time and fees often under $0.10 for simple transfers, Tron provides an infrastructure that can handle massive transaction volumes without the congestion issues that have plagued other networks.

Ethereum remains crucial for USDT’s institutional adoption and DeFi integration. Approximately 70% of decentralized exchange trades on Ethereum involve Tether pairs, making it the backbone of the decentralized finance ecosystem. While Ethereum’s fees are higher than Tron’s, the network’s robust smart contract capabilities and established ecosystem make it indispensable for more complex financial applications.

Newer networks like Polygon, Solana, and various Layer 2 solutions have also gained significant USDT adoption. Polygon and Solana now host 3.7 billion and 2.2 billion USDT respectively, while newer entrants like zkSync and Base have been added to target users seeking even faster and cheaper transactions.

The Competitive Landscape: Why USDT Leads

Understanding Tether’s dominance requires examining what sets it apart from competitors like USD Coin (USDC) and other stablecoins. While USDC has gained significant ground, particularly among institutional users and in regulated markets, capturing approximately 21.8% of the stablecoin market, it still trails USDT significantly in terms of overall adoption and daily usage.

Several factors contribute to USDT’s competitive advantages. First-mover advantage played a crucial role, as USDT was among the first stablecoins to achieve widespread adoption and liquidity. This early adoption created network effects that have been difficult for competitors to overcome. When new users enter the cryptocurrency ecosystem, they often gravitate toward the most liquid and widely accepted options, which consistently points to USDT.

Accessibility represents another key differentiator. While USDC has focused heavily on regulatory compliance and institutional adoption, USDT has prioritized global accessibility and ease of use. This has made USDT particularly popular in emerging markets where access to traditional banking services may be limited, but cryptocurrency adoption is high.

The cost structure also favors USDT in many use cases. On networks like Tron, USDT transactions can be completed for fractions of a dollar, making it practical for small-value transactions and frequent trading. This cost advantage has been particularly important for applications like gaming, remittances, and day-to-day commerce where transaction fees can significantly impact user experience.

Liquidity depth represents perhaps USDT’s most significant competitive moat. With daily trading volumes consistently exceeding $75 billion and widespread availability across virtually every major cryptocurrency exchange, USDT offers unparalleled liquidity for users looking to enter or exit positions quickly. This liquidity advantage creates a self-reinforcing cycle where increased usage leads to better liquidity, which in turn attracts more users.

Global Adoption Patterns and Use Cases

Tether’s adoption varies significantly across different regions and use cases, reflecting the diverse needs of the global cryptocurrency community. In emerging markets, USDT has become a crucial tool for preserving purchasing power against local currency devaluation and facilitating cross-border transactions. Countries experiencing high inflation or currency controls have seen particularly strong USDT adoption, as citizens use the stablecoin to access dollar-denominated value storage.

Cross-border business-to-business settlements using Tether have surged, particularly in the Middle East and Southeast Asia, with over $30 billion settled in Q1 2025 alone. This represents a fundamental shift in how international commerce operates, allowing businesses to bypass traditional correspondent banking relationships and settle transactions in minutes rather than days.

The fastest-growing Tether market is Southeast Asia, which has seen a 36% year-over-year increase in on-chain transactions. This growth reflects both the region’s rapid digitization and the practical advantages that USDT provides for cross-border commerce and remittances within the region.

In Eastern Europe, peer-to-peer USDT transfers now make up over 27% of total crypto volume in some regions, indicating USDT’s role as a practical alternative to traditional banking services. This usage pattern demonstrates how stablecoins can provide financial services to populations that may have limited access to traditional banking infrastructure or prefer the privacy and speed of cryptocurrency transactions.

Over 70% of over-the-counter crypto trades in emerging economies are settled in USDT, underlining its role as a de facto digital dollar in many markets. This statistic reveals how USDT has become the bridge currency for cryptocurrency trading, allowing users to move between different cryptocurrencies without needing to convert back to fiat currency.

The Technology Behind the Transactions

The technical implementation of USDT across different blockchain networks demonstrates sophisticated engineering designed to optimize for different use cases and user preferences. Each network offers distinct advantages that serve different segments of the USDT user base.

On the Tron network, USDT benefits from a unique resource model that uses bandwidth and energy rather than traditional gas fees. Users receive 600 free bandwidth points daily, sufficient for basic TRX transfers. For USDT transfers, which require energy to execute smart contracts, users can either stake TRX to generate free energy or pay fees in TRX. This system allows for very low transaction costs, typically ranging from $0.40 for transfers to wallets that already contain USDT, to around $3.38 for transfers to empty wallets.

The Ethereum implementation of USDT leverages the network’s robust smart contract capabilities and established ecosystem. While transaction fees on Ethereum are typically higher than Tron, ranging from $5 to $50 during peak congestion, the network’s maturity and integration with decentralized finance applications make it essential for more complex use cases.

Newer implementations on networks like Polygon and Arbitrum aim to combine the best of both worlds, offering low fees similar to Tron while maintaining compatibility with Ethereum’s ecosystem. These Layer 2 solutions have seen rapid growth, with some networks experiencing over 100% growth in USDT adoption within a single year.

Regulatory Landscape and Future Outlook

The regulatory environment surrounding USDT continues to evolve, with significant implications for its future dominance. The passage of the GENIUS Act in the United States has created a framework for stablecoin regulation that may require Tether to make significant operational changes to maintain access to U.S. markets.

Tether has announced plans to launch a separate U.S.-compliant stablecoin by the end of 2025, which would operate alongside USDT but meet the stricter regulatory requirements imposed by U.S. legislation. This dual-token strategy represents Tether’s recognition that regulatory compliance will be crucial for long-term success in developed markets, while the existing USDT token can continue serving international markets.

The competitive landscape may shift as regulatory clarity increases. Circle’s USDC has positioned itself as the more compliant alternative, particularly in regulated markets, and has seen significant institutional adoption as a result. However, USDT’s massive liquidity advantage and entrenched position in global markets suggest that it will remain dominant for the foreseeable future.

Future technological developments may also impact USDT’s competitive position. Central bank digital currencies (CBDCs), when they become widely available, could provide government-backed alternatives to stablecoins. However, the decentralized, borderless nature of USDT provides advantages that CBDCs, which are likely to be more controlled and restricted, may not be able to match.
